Common Oral Lesions Diagnosed Through Biopsy
Oral lesions appear in many forms, including ulcers, patches, or swellings. While some resolve naturally, others demand clinical attention. At Axay Dental, clinicians identify benign and potentially serious lesions through biopsy.
For instance, leukoplakia presents as white patches that cannot be scraped off. Similarly, erythroplakia appears as red lesions and often requires immediate assessment. Because these conditions may signal cellular changes, a biopsy ensures clarity and guides next steps.

Diagnosing Inflammatory and Autoimmune Oral Conditions
Several inflammatory and autoimmune disorders affect oral tissues. Conditions such as oral lichen planus or pemphigus vulgaris often mimic common mouth sores. However, they require specific management.

Evaluating Chronic Ulcers and Non-Healing Wounds
Chronic ulcers that fail to heal within two weeks raise concern. Dentists at Axay Dental assess these lesions carefully. When routine care fails, a biopsy reveals underlying causes such as infection, trauma, or systemic disease.

Oral Infections and Fungal Conditions
Certain fungal and viral infections mimic other oral disorders. Candidiasis, for example, may resemble leukoplakia. Therefore, a biopsy helps differentiate conditions accurately.
